Phillip E. Baker Phillip Eugene Baker, 78, of Red Wing, died Tuesday at his residence. He was born March 13, 1929, in Graettinger, Iowa to Snowden and Blanche (Wilson) Baker. He graduated from Jackson High School, in Jackson, Minn. in 1948. He married Audrey Majerus on June 24, 1983, in Minneapolis where they lived prior to moving to Red Wing in 2002. He worked as a commercial traffic manager for Greif Brothers Corp. prior to retiring in 1994. He enjoyed reading and writing, fishing and playing cards. He was a member of the New River Assembly of God Church. He is survived by his wife, Audrey of Red Wing; seven sons, Steven (Barbara) Baker of Hastings, Eric (Cheryl) Baker of Akeley, Minn., Jeffery (Mary Wenzlaff) Baker of Hartford, Wis., Todd (Brenda) Baker of La Porte, Minn., Sean Graves of Minneapolis, Patrick Graves of Northfield, and Colin (Karen) Graves of Red Wing; 12 grandchildren; two brothers, Robert Gailen Baker of Montana, Carrol (Maude) Baker of Dickens, Iowa; and one sister, Marvel Houge of Estherville, Iowa. He was preceded in death by his parents and one brother, Richard Baker. Funeral will be 11 a.m. Friday at New River Assembly of God Church with Reverend Tom Johnson officiating. Burial will be in Oakwood Cemetery. Visitation will be from 4 -7 p.m. Thursday at Mahn Family Funeral Home, Bodelson-Mahn Chapel, and one hour prior to the time of services Friday at the church. Memorials are preferred to Red Wing Area Hospice or the church.
